SOLON — Nomination papers are available for the following elected positions: selectman/assessor/overseer of the poor, 2014-17; road commissioner, 2014-15; town clerk/tax collector, 2014-15; treasurer, 2014-15; Regional School Unity 74 school board member, 2014-17.
Nomination papers can be requested from the town clerk and must be returned to the town clerk by the end of business day, Wednesday, Jan. 15. Qualifying signatures must come from registered voters. For more information, call 643-2812 or mail Solon Town Clerk, 121 South Main St., P.O. Box 214, Solon, ME 04979.
